Job Description
We are working with a client who is seeking an Project Manager to lead a critical programme involving the restructure and consolidation of multiple site project. The ideal candidate will have experience working in this area and delivering this type of work previously.
Client Details
Our client is a medium-sized organisation operating within the distribution industry, known for its commitment to innovation and efficiency. The company places a strong emphasis on delivering high-quality solutions within its technology department.
Description
- Lead the end-to-end delivery of site restructures and consolidation projects
- Plan and coordinate the decommissioning of sites, including infrastructure, systems, and assets
- Oversee the migration of hardware and software to other operational sites
- Manage implementation partners, technical teams, and third-party vendors
- Ensure business continuity and minimise operational impact during transitions
- Develop and maintain detailed project plans, RAID logs, and reporting
- Engage and manage key stakeholders across IT, operations, and leadership
- Ensure all activities are completed in line with governance, compliance, and security standards
Profile
- Proven project management experience delivering office relocation, or consolidation projects
- Experience in logistics, retail, supply chain sectors.
- Strong background in project management of IT infrastructure / hardware & software migration
- Excellent stakeholder management and communication skills
- Ability to manage multiple work streams and dependencies
- Experience working in fast-paced, transformation-driven environments
- Strong risk management and problem-solving capabilities
- Familiarity with project management methodologies (Agile, Waterfall, or hybrid)
